Western Regional Minister Orders Immediate Harbour Evacuation After Landslide Fire

The Western Regional Minister, Honourable Joseph Nelson has directed an immediate evacuation of all individuals operating along landslide prone sections of the Albert Bosomtwi Sam Fishing Harbour in Sekondi following a fire outbreak linked to recent rainfall activity. The directive followed an emergency assessment after a landslide damaged infrastructure and triggered safety risks within the harbour enclave.

The Western Regional Minister explained that continuous rainfall over several days contributed to soil instability which led to the collapse of a section of the harbour area. He indicated that the movement of earth brought down structures close to electrical installations, creating conditions that resulted in fire when contact occurred.

Honourable Nelson noted that emergency responders acted swiftly to contain the situation and limit destruction within the facility. He commended the Ghana National Fire Service for their rapid intervention which prevented a wider escalation of the incident.

“It is a natural occurrence as it is a landslide caused by the rains we have experienced over the last few days. The continuous rainfall has weakened the ground and caused that portion of the fishing harbour to collapse. The electrical wires were very close to the wall and when the collapse happened it made contact and triggered the fire.”

Furthermore, he emphasised that the situation requires urgent attention beyond immediate response measures. The Western Regional Minister stressed that the ongoing rainfall pattern continues to pose risks of further landslides within the area.

Honourable Nelson subsequently directed that all persons operating within the affected stretch relocate without delay. He explained that the unpredictability of such incidents leaves no room for continued occupation of high risk zones.

He further highlighted that precautionary evacuation remains the most effective means of safeguarding lives. He warned that ignoring safety directives could expose residents and workers to preventable hazards if further ground movement occurs.

Subsequently, he urged stakeholders at the harbour to treat the situation as a critical warning. He added that the visible instability of the terrain indicates potential for recurrence if preventive action is not taken promptly.

 Risk Surveillance and Safety Culture Urged After Harbour Incident

The Western Regional Minister, Honourable Joseph Nelson highlighted the importance of early detection systems in reducing the impact of environmental hazards.

Honourable Nelson explained that the recent incident demonstrates the need for continuous observation of high risk areas, especially during periods of heavy rainfall. He noted that similar environmental conditions could arise in other locations, requiring proactive safety awareness.

He stressed that institutional preparedness must be complemented by individual responsibility to reduce exposure to avoidable dangers. The Western Regional Minister indicated that both public agencies and residents have roles in identifying and eliminating potential risks.

“At any point in time we should be detecting risk of fire anywhere and everywhere so that when we come across one we take it out of the way. We must all be alert to anything that could lead to danger within our surroundings. This includes our homes, workplaces and public spaces where hidden risks may exist. Acting early prevents disasters before they happen.”

The Western Regional Minsiter noted that the Ghana Ports and Harbours Authority has demonstrated commitment in managing safety conditions at the harbour. He encouraged continued collaboration between technical teams and regulatory bodies to strengthen monitoring systems.

Honourable Nelson added that environmental changes during rainy seasons require heightened awareness from all communities. He explained that small warning signs often precede major incidents and should not be overlooked.

He also urged the public to respond promptly to safety alerts issued by authorities. He indicated that compliance with evacuation and precautionary instructions rare essential in preventing loss of life.

He stressed that risk management should extend beyond the harbour environment into daily living conditions. He pointed out that households and workplaces must also prioritise identification of structural or environmental dangers.

The Western Regional Minister further called for sustained education on disaster preparedness to build a stronger safety culture. He emphasised that consistent awareness creation will help reduce vulnerability across communities exposed to natural hazards.
